(AL) Alabama Sewer Projects Contractor Exam Practice Questions
10 MOST-TESTED EXAM COVERAGE AREAS
1. Sewer Pipe Installation and Layout — sewer pipe materials, pipe joints, bedding, alignment,
grade, trench preparation, pipe laying, connections, manholes, cleanouts, and proper
installation practices.
2. Sewer Flow, Slope, and Drainage — gravity flow, minimum slope concepts, invert elevations,
pipe grade, drainage patterns, flow direction, hydraulic performance, and preventing standing
water.
3. Sewer Testing, Inspection, and Connections — leakage testing, pressure testing, inspection,
infiltration, exfiltration, service connections, manholes, cleanouts, and correction of installation
defects.
4. Septic Tanks and Components — septic tank function, sizing concepts, inlet and outlet
arrangements, baffles, access covers, sludge and scum, distribution systems, and maintenance.
5. Drain Fields and Onsite Sewage Systems — soil conditions, absorption areas, trench layout,
distribution, setbacks, site evaluation, drainage, system protection, and proper operation.
6. Excavation and Trenching — trench layout, excavation equipment, trench depth, spoil
placement, trench boxes, sloping, benching, shoring, access, groundwater, and soil conditions.
7. Grading, Bedding, Backfill, and Compaction — elevations, grade control, bedding materials,
haunching, initial backfill, final backfill, compaction, settlement prevention, and surface
restoration.
8. Stormwater and Site Drainage — runoff, erosion, drainage structures, temporary controls,
sediment control, swales, ditches, culverts, inlet protection, and site drainage during
construction.
9. Construction Safety and OSHA — trench safety, competent-person duties, protective systems,
ladders, falling hazards, equipment operation, confined spaces, utilities, PPE, and emergency
procedures.
10. Alabama Requirements and Contractor Practices — Alabama contractor requirements, sewer-
project classification, onsite sewage requirements, Alabama One Call concepts, permits, plans,
inspections, documentation, and responsible construction practices. The Alabama Board
identifies Sewer Projects as a specialty under Municipal and Utility construction. (PSI Online)

During installation of a gravity sewer, why should the contractor carefully maintain the designed pipe


grade throughout the entire trench length?


A. To increase pipe color


B. To maintain proper wastewater flow


C. To reduce pipe diameter


D. To eliminate all manholes


Answer: B


Rationale: Correct pipe grade helps wastewater flow by gravity and reduces areas where solids or water


can collect.

Before workers enter a newly excavated sewer trench, what should the competent person do first to


protect workers from excavation hazards?


A. Start laying pipe


B. Inspect the excavation and protective system


C. Remove all warning signs


D. Add water to the trench

Answer: B


Rationale: OSHA excavation rules require inspection of excavations and protective systems by a


competent person.




3.


When installing a gravity sewer pipe, what is the main purpose of properly prepared bedding beneath


the pipe?


A. To increase pipe weight


B. To support the pipe evenly


C. To reduce pipe length


D. To prevent all groundwater


Answer: B


Rationale: Proper bedding provides uniform support and helps maintain pipe alignment and grade.
